The latest total current liabilities for XELA is $89M as of June 2025. That compares with $410M in the prior-year period — down 78.3% year over year. Investors often review this figure alongside Exela Technologies's historical trend and sector peers before judging valuation or financial health.

Over the past year, XELA's total current liabilities moved from $410M to $89M — a 78.3% year-over-year decrease. If the trend continues in the same direction for several quarters, it can signal a meaningful shift in Exela Technologies's operating scale or balance-sheet position.
